What is an objective function in a linear programming problem?

The objective function in a linear programming problem is the function that needs to be optimized (either minimized or maximized). This function represents the main goal of the problem, such as minimizing costs or maximizing profits.

Linear programming is a method for determining a way to achieve the best outcome in a mathematical model whose requirements are represented by linear relationships.

The objective function is one of the two main components of a linear programming problem, along with constraints. The objective function represents the quantity which needs to be minimized or maximized. For instance, it could represent the total cost of materials to be minimized, or the total profit to be maximized.
